Transaction 7dfee37c4bda5c59aee6cc4fa61378745117ce8fcfc9efbabeb4e86bfc196034
2 Input
2 Outputs
- 7dfee37c4bda5c59aee6cc4fa61378745117ce8fcfc9efbabeb4e86bfc196034:0
- 7dfee37c4bda5c59aee6cc4fa61378745117ce8fcfc9efbabeb4e86bfc196034:1
value 3660000
address 3FPmcxf6wVJUCFXYVQqkPV2fDWtRG1Y2Xz
value 42584
address 1FGDuGrhVBWba1YNvGsW6qWqDwXDgaRYk